Possibility to change X2 Visa when expired to L type

Currently I'm having a X2 Student one and I'm leaving 26-08 and I will stay till 17-02 next year to study at the Beijing University of Technology. I just collected my student one and it stated that the 'duration of each stay' is 150 days. This is correct according to the university's schedule but I have the intention to stay 30 more days to travel around China. Is it possible to change my X2 one to the L one when the first one almost expires? And is it possible to do that without leaving China?

You cannot change your X2 to a L when your X2 almost expires within China if you apply in your own.
It is suggested to take time to visit around China during your studying in China, or you can try to find a local tour agency to help you to apply one in China. It is reminded that applying through a tour agency may be a little bit expensive.
